The grille of a Chrysler P/T Cruiser in metallic blue. When inverted, it reminds me of an art moderene apartment building. Thi s is an illusion of scale and I am 100% sure it is DOOMED but I like it.

The original image was flipped 180 degrees. Hue/sat was goosed a little, but not much. Duplicate layer was created and the colors were inverted. The layer was set to "difference" mode and faded.

Thanks to all who have "defended" my whimsical "illusion of scale", and understood that it is a thought-out image, not a stuffed-in one. It's not in my nature to do "set-ups"; I photograph what I see, only very rarely creating something for the purposes of a challenge. I sometimes arrange things (like peppers and cilantro, or a sculpture in a refrigerator) but can't recall offhand ever having created an entire shot for DPC.

I too was mildly suprised this didn't do a bit better; I thought it was an interesting "illusion" and a creative one. But so it goes.

As for those who commented negatively on the "noise", there IS NO NOISE IN THIS SHOT! That's blue metalflake paint... I have seen few better examples than this shot of the absurd, knee-jerk reaction against "noise" in DPC... Geesh... Better not photograph metalflake paint any more, it's too noisy...
